Account Management Client Support Analyst
Primary Responsibilities: The function has as objective to provide support to commercial area and our clients, managing the account on operational tasks requests, client data maintenance and client support. Includes the following but is not necessarily an exhaustive list of all responsibilities, duties, performance standards or requirement efforts, skills, or working conditions associated with the job.
Generate, distribute, and monitor managerial reports such w8s expired, pending documents and others.
Provide monitoring for Client Data between both units.
Support and coordinate inquiries and investigations.
Serves customers by providing product and service information, resolving products and service problems
Receives customers' requests by telephone, email, secure messages, 360 CRM or chat, and analyzes these requests to provides solution or additional information
Maintain customer records by updating account information
Ability to provide customer service over the phone, in person, and through Online Chat.
Provide customers with training on the different Electronic Services the bank offers
Knowledge on the Credit Card process, preferable with FIS.
Knowledge on the ATM, and Debit Card process
Ability to process all services request in a timely fashion matter, including but not limited to callbacks, wire transfers, ACH and Bill payment setups, Check Payments Request, Credit Disbursement, Clients/Account maintenance, investigations, Reference Letters, and Credit Card Payments.
Fees setup and exceptions requests.
CDs requests and ACATs preparation.
Knowledge of W8-s for preparation and renewals
Support department employees on their daily work and projects
Support Audit and Regulators demands.
Attracts potential customers by answering product and service questions; suggesting information requested or ascertains who can best provide the information, and routes the request to the proper person
